This is important public contact work, on a part-time basis, accurately collecting cash and electronic credit and debit payments for goods and services provided at a Parks and Recreation facility. Work involves the correct recording of transactions; and providing general assistance and answering patrons' questions regarding the nature preserve and its programs.
Work involves the rapid and accurate completion of transactions and requires extreme accuracy. The work schedule varies and may include assignments on weekends and holidays.
Salary: $15.99 - $21.28 Hourly
Close Date: Open Until Filled
To Qualify
Minimum Qualifications. Applicants must:
Possess a valid high school diploma or GED equivalency.
Have at least six (6) months experience as a cashier, bookkeeper, teller, or similar position.
Have prior experience with money handling, cash registers, and computers.
Be flexible to work a varied day shift schedule, including weekends and holidays.
Have some customer service experience.
